加入收藏 | 设为首页 | 会员中心 | 我要投稿 草根网 (https://www.0791zz.com/)- 数据采集、数据开发、AI开发硬件、网络安全、建站!
当前位置: 首页 > 视图计算 > 正文

视图计算在数据库缓存技术中的应用

发布时间:2024-05-18 15:51:08 所属栏目:视图计算 来源:狂人写作
导读:  视图计算在数据库缓存技术中的应用已经成为提升数据处理效率和优化数据结构的重要手段。数据库缓存技术的主要目的是减少数据库访问的频繁性,通过缓存数据,使得常用的数据可以快速地从内存中获取,而无需每次都

  视图计算在数据库缓存技术中的应用已经成为提升数据处理效率和优化数据结构的重要手段。数据库缓存技术的主要目的是减少数据库访问的频繁性,通过缓存数据,使得常用的数据可以快速地从内存中获取,而无需每次都从磁盘上的数据库中读取。这种技术可以显著提高数据的访问速度,从而提升整个系统的性能。

  视图计算是数据库查询的一种重要技术,它允许用户通过预定义的查询语句,将复杂的数据操作封装起来,形成一个虚拟的表。用户可以直接对这个虚拟表进行查询,而无需知道其背后的复杂查询逻辑。图形计算不仅简化了用户的查询操作,而且提供了数据抽象和包装的能力,使数据操作更加安全和可控。

  在数据库缓存技术中,视图计算的应用主要体现在以下几个方面:

  1. 缓存优化:通过视图计算,可以将复杂的数据查询逻辑封装起来,形成一个虚拟的表。这个虚拟表可以被缓存到内存中,当用户需要查询这个表时,直接从内存中获取,而无需每次都执行复杂的查询操作。这样可以大大减少数据库的访问次数,提高数据的访问速度。

  2. 数据抽象和封装:视图计算提供了数据抽象和封装的能力,可以将复杂的数据结构和操作隐藏起来,只向用户提供简单、易用的接口。这样,用户可以无需关心数据背后的复杂逻辑,只需要通过视图计算进行简单的查询操作即可。

  3. 数据安全控制:视图计算还可以用于数据安全控制。通过定义不同的视图,可以限制用户对数据的访问权限。例如,可以定义一个只包含部分字段的视图,使得用户只能访问到这些字段的数据,而无法访问到其他的敏感数据。

  综上所述,视图计算在数据库缓存技术中的应用具有重要意义。不但能提高数据访问速度,优化数据结构,还能提供数据抽象和封装能力,实现数据安全控制。随着数据库技术的不断发展,视图计算在数据库缓存技术中的应用将会越来越广泛。

(编辑:草根网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章